Contact
DMCA
Privacy
Robuta
https://thamesfestivaltrust.org/
Thames Festival Trust | Arts, Culture, Education & Heritage | Thames Festival Trust
Delivering diverse arts, education, heritage events and projects along the River Thames and abroad.
thames festival trust
arts culture
education
heritage